Design practice will study ways of improving access to Poplar DLR station

Planning and design practice, Urban Initiatives, has been appointed to carry out a study on behalf of Docklands Light Railway.

The study is to find out ways that access can be improved to Poplar DLR station and how the service can be made more user-friendly for local residents.

Jon Tricker, associate director at Urban Initiatives said: “We’re going to be preparing design solutions for Poplar station and its access routes working with John McAslan & Partners, Intelligent Space Partnership and Castle Hayes Pursey. We want to achieve a step change in the quality of walking routed from stations to residential areas, to encourage wider public use of the DLR.”
